HeisMendoza. With one word, the Indianapolis Star captured what Indiana fans had waited 136 years to see: a Hoosier holding college football's most prestigious individual award. On December 13, 2025, Fernando Mendoza stood at Lincoln Center in New York City and made history as Indiana's first-ever Heisman Trophy winner. He dominated the voting with 2,362 points and 643 first-place votes—nearly a thousand-point margin over runner-up Diego Pavia of Vanderbilt. Then he broke down in tears and delivered a heartwarming speech, at times in his native Spanish, thanking his family, his teammates, and Hoosier Nation.
The numbers told the story all season long: 2,980 passing yards, 33 touchdowns through the air, another 240 yards and six scores on the ground. But Mendoza's Heisman wasn't won on stats alone. It was sealed when he got knocked to the turf on the first play of the Big Ten Championship Game, got back up, and led Indiana to a 13-10 victory over the number one team in the country.
